if a < b and c < d
is this valid?
a/c < b/d

Not necessarily,
If you use the following values:
a = 2
b = 3
c = 1
and d = 2
a < b
2 < 3
c < d
1 < 2
However:
a/c = 2/1 = 2
b/d = 3/2 = 1.5
Therefore, since 2 is greater than 1.5, I'm afraid your statement is not valid
